Insights from local study sites

MalariaGEN partners across 14 malaria-endemic countries have worked with local communities to recruit over 50,000 samples in the last 4 years. Each partner has designed and implemented their own local study into the natural mechanisms of resistence to malaria. Learn more about the challenges faced and experiences gained by these partners.
